Output 23590d61129608a9c7928bbdfe8336ca0f3d7d2fea383b499e9ec2f24e41c5a9:1

value
306614
script pubkey
OP_0 OP_PUSHBYTES_20 8069ef68af9d3ea4f08b64d8d439acb6f14d5144
address
tb1qsp577690n5l2fuytvnvdgwdvkmc5652ymuefwu
transaction
23590d61129608a9c7928bbdfe8336ca0f3d7d2fea383b499e9ec2f24e41c5a9